Advertisement

使用VideoView实现本地与网络视频播放,包括滑动控制进度、调节音量及亮度、锁定屏幕、分享、显示进度和双击暂停等功能

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目利用VideoView组件实现视频播放器功能,支持本地和在线视频,具备进度拖拽、音量/亮度调节、锁屏操作、分享以及双击暂停等实用特性。 这是我自己完成的一个小项目,相关思路已经发表在一篇博客里。项目的功能都在那篇博客中有详细介绍。该项目是在Android Studio 2.3.3环境下开发的。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 使VideoView
    优质
    本项目利用VideoView组件实现视频播放器功能,支持本地和在线视频,具备进度拖拽、音量/亮度调节、锁屏操作、分享以及双击暂停等实用特性。 这是我自己完成的一个小项目,相关思路已经发表在一篇博客里。项目的功能都在那篇博客中有详细介绍。该项目是在Android Studio 2.3.3环境下开发的。
  • 【FFmpeg】使 ffplay 命令操作止、
    优质
    本教程详细介绍如何利用ffplay命令行工具便捷地控制视频文件,包括播放、暂停、停止、调整音量和进度等功能。 本段落介绍了使用FFmpeg中的ffplay命令进行视频播放的各种操作方法,包括但不限于:如何播放、暂停、停止视频;音量控制的方法;进度调整技巧;以及音频流、视频流、字幕流的切换与节目选择等。这些内容可以帮助用户更高效地利用ffplay工具来处理多媒体文件。
  • 使 PyQt5 、全模式截图操作
    优质
    本项目利用PyQt5框架开发,实现了一个具备基本视频播放需求的应用程序。用户可以进行视频播放暂停,调节播放进度与音量大小,并支持全屏观看以及截取当前画面等功能。 PyQt5 可以实现视频播放功能,并包含常用的进度控制、声音控制、全屏播放以及截图等功能。详细内容可以参考相关技术博客文章。
  • 基于Swift开发的iOS器,具备、拖倍速
    优质
    这是一款采用Swift语言开发的高效iOS平台视频播放器应用,提供滑动调节音量与屏幕亮度,支持通过拖动快速调整播放进度,并兼容倍速播放功能。 BLVideoPlayer是一款用Swift编写的视频播放器,具备亮度调节、音量调节、拖动快进、横竖屏切换以及在竖屏模式下通过上下滑动来切换视频的功能。代码被封装成一个框架(framework),便于调用和集成使用。更多详情可以参考相关博文。
  • Android开发中条的效果SeekBar的基:如
    优质
    本文详细介绍了在Android开发过程中如何实现各种类型的进度条效果,并重点讲解了SeekBar组件的基础用法,包括但不限于音量调整、音乐播放进度显示与控制以及视频播放进度的管理。通过实例解析,帮助开发者深入理解并掌握这些UI元素的应用技巧。 本段落介绍了在Android开发中如何实现进度条效果,并且详细讲解了SeekBar的简单使用方法。其中包括音量控制、音乐播放进度显示以及视频播放进度等功能的应用实例。
  • Unity中条的
    优质
    本教程详细介绍如何在Unity引擎中实现视频进度条的控制功能,包括视频的播放、暂停以及拖动进度条调整播放位置等操作。 使用进度条播放视频可以实现快进或快退,并且具备暂停功能。
  • JS作的器,具备
    优质
    这款使用JavaScript编写的音乐播放器支持歌曲播放进度实时显示及音量调整功能,为用户提供便捷流畅的听歌体验。 在JavaScript的世界里,创建一个功能丰富的播放器是一项常见的挑战。这个项目展示了如何使用JS来实现这样的功能,使得网页上的音频播放体验接近于专门的媒体播放器。以下是关键知识点的详细解释: 1. **HTML5 Audio API**: 这个播放器的基础是HTML5中的`
  • 基于SurfaceViewMediaPlayer的器,具备选集、试看(拖条)、整、弹横竖切换。
    优质
    这是一款采用SurfaceView与MediaPlayer技术打造的多功能视频播放器,支持选集播放、试看模式、音量和亮度调节以及弹幕互动,并兼容横竖屏幕自由切换。 使用SurfaceView与MediaPlayer可以构建一个功能全面的播放器,支持选集、拖动进度条预览以及重新试看等功能。此外,该播放器还具备音量调节、亮度调整及横竖屏自动切换的功能,并且内置了弹幕系统,方便扩展如锁屏等其他实用特性。
  • 使WPFC#全面的条、截图、
    优质
    本项目采用WPF与C#开发,旨在构建一个具备全方位功能的视频播放器,涵盖进度控制、截屏及精准视频定位等功能。 实现的功能包括:视频播放器的进度条、截屏、暂停、停止、静音、音量调节以及视频定位。
  • 为ffplay添加OSD
    优质
    本项目旨在增强FFmpeg中的ffplay工具,新增实时音量调节功能,并在界面上动态展示当前音量大小和播放进度,提升用户体验。 给ffplay添加了音量控制功能,并通过OSD方式显示音量大小和播放进度。